This book covers vibration testing and identification of dynamic structural systems: structural dynamics, methods of modal analysis and model identification, vibration testing with a detailed measurement system, software, practical applications, and case studies of full-scale structures.


List of contents










1 Introduction 2 Fundamental of Structural Dynamics 3 Modal Analysis Based on Power Spectral Density Data 4 Modal Analysis Based on Cross-correlation Data 5 System Identification Based on Vector Autoregressive Moving Average Models 6 Modal updating by minimizing errors in modal parameters 7 Bayesian Model Updating Based on Markov chain Monte Carlo


About the author










Lam, Heung Fai is currently Associate Professor at Department of Architecture and Civil Engineering, City University of Hong Kong, and Associate Editor of Engineering Structures.
Yang, Jia-Hua is currently Associate Professor at College of Civil Engineering and Architecture and Scientific Research Center of Engineering Mechanics, Guangxi University (China).
